* [PATCH v2 manager 1/1] ceph: init: clean up deprecated pg_bits parameter 2026-03-28 11:23 [PATCH v2 manager 0/1] ceph: init: clean up deprecated pg_bits parameter Kefu Chai @ 2026-03-28 11:23 ` Kefu Chai 2026-05-07 13:22 ` Kefu Chai 1 sibling, 0 replies; 3+ messages in thread From: Kefu Chai @ 2026-03-28 11:23 UTC (permalink / raw) To: pve-devel The pg_bits parameter was deprecated in commit 9b15baf (PVE 8) after the underlying Ceph config options (osd_pg_bits / osd_pgp_bits) were removed from Ceph in v13.0.2. It has been a guaranteed no-op on every cluster PVE 9 can manage. Removing the API parameter itself would be a breaking change during the 9.x release cycle, so keep it as a documented no-op until PVE 10. Only remove the dead-code comments that referenced it in the implementation, and fix the typos in the TODO and description.
